Warning Signs You Need Basement Water Removal in Eloy, AZ

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s, health risks, and further damage to your property. Don’t wait any longer to take action, contact our team today to schedule a consultation and ensure your basement is safe and dry.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ors in your basement can be a sign of hidden moisture and potential mold growth. If you notice a musty smell that lingers even after cleaning, it’s time to call our team for help.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Noticeable water stains or discoloration on your walls, ceiling, or floors can show a larger issue with water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, our team can help you address the problem before it’s too late.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or poor ventilation in your basement. Our team can help you identify the root cause of the issue and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Cracks in Walls or Ceiling

Cracks in your walls or ceiling can be a sign of structural damage or water pressure. If you notice any cracks,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Water Pooling Around Your Foundation

Water pooling around your foundation can be a sign of a larger issue with your home’s drainage system. Our team can help you identify the root cause of the problem and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

High Humidity Levels

High humidity levels in your basement can lead to mold growth, structural damage, and further health risks. If you notice high humidity levels, it’s time to call our team for help to ensure your basement is safe and dry.

Common Questions About Basement Water Removal

Q: What causes water in my basement?

A: Water in your basement can be caused by various factors, including heavy rainfall, burst pipes, poor ventilation, and high water tables. Our team can help you identify the root cause of the issue and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Q: Is basement water removal covered by insurance?

A: In most cases, basement water removal is covered by insurance if it’s caused by a sudden and unexpected event, such as a burst pipe or heavy rainfall. But, coverage may vary depending on your policy and provider. Our team can help you navigate the insurance process and ensure you receive the coverage you deserve.

Q: How long does it take to dry out my basement?

A: The time it takes to dry out your basement dep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the effectiveness of our drying equipment. In most cases, our team can dry out your basement within 24-48 hours, depending on the specifics of your situation.
